How Can I Forget You, is a 1956 Egyptian movie, directed by Ahmad Badrakhan, and starring Farid Al-Atrash, Sabah, Karima. with a runtime of 137 minutes.
How Can I Forget You is a classic Egyptian musical romance starring the golden-voiced Farid al-Atrash alongside Sabah and Nadia Jamal. The film follows two orphaned sisters — one a singer, the other a dancer — who flee their exploitative mother and her scheming husband to seek refuge with a celebrated musical star. When Farid al-Atrash discovers the elder sister's extraordinary singing talent, he takes her under his wing and love quietly blooms between them. But jealousy intervenes when a rival woman conspires with an accomplice to deceive the singer and separate the two lovers. A melodious, emotionally rich film from Egypt's golden age of cinema.
